Destination York is an 8-week pathway program that you can enrol in after applying to a degree program at York. Successful completion of Destination York fulfills the York U language entry requirement, with no test required (no IELTS or TOEFL). The program is taught by qualified instructors and features an innovative curriculum. Students enrolled in the program will also have access to support services.

The online Destination York Program is an accelerated English for Academic Purpose Program that offers conditional acceptance to more than 100 York undergraduate programs. Destination York is designed to help high school graduates with an IELTS score of 6.0 prepare for study at York University. Successful completion of Destination York fulfills the York U IELTS 6.5 language requirement with no test required (IELTS or TOEFL).
The program is 8 weeks in length with 30 hours per week of online learning. Daily sessions include 4.5 hours of synchronous online learning delivered by two expert instructors, as well as 1.5 hours of asynchronous online learning to work on assignments.

The Destination York Program is designed to help high school graduates to prepare for study at York University in Toronto. This program focuses on the language skills required to succeed in York undergraduate courses. Graduating high school students who are eligible to join Destination York will be among a select group of high achievers who are motivated to improve their academic English skills.
The program will run for 30 hours per week over 8 weeks. Typically, a 6 hour day will be split between advanced-level speaking, listening, reading and writing activities and content-based modules (academic discussion topics, readings and debates).*
* York University English Language Institute program classes will in most cases run according to the schedule noted. Based on program requirements and increased student registrations, some program schedules may need be shifted to evenings (4.50pm-8.50pm) and Saturdays.
